Who needs reliance capital builder fund?
01
Individuals looking for long-term wealth creation: The reliance capital builder fund is suitable for those who want to invest for a longer duration and potentially grow their wealth over time.
02
Investors with medium to high risk tolerance: This fund may be suitable for investors who are willing to take on a medium to high level of risk in pursuit of potentially higher returns.
03
Individuals looking for diversification: The reliance capital builder fund invests in a diversified portfolio of stocks across different sectors. This can provide investors with exposure to a wide range of companies and industries, reducing the risk associated with concentrated investments.
04
Investors seeking professional management: By investing in the reliance capital builder fund, individuals can benefit from the expertise of professional fund managers who actively manage the portfolio to optimize returns based on market conditions.
05
Those looking for tax benefits: The reliance capital builder fund offers the option of investing in the growth or dividend plan. Depending on the individual's tax bracket and investment goals, the dividend plan may offer tax advantages.
In summary, anyone who aims to achieve long-term wealth creation, has a medium to high risk tolerance, seeks diversification, prefers professional management, and potentially wants tax benefits may consider investing in the reliance capital builder fund. However, it is important to carefully assess one's financial goals, risk appetite, and consult with a financial advisor before making any investment decisions.

What is reliance capital builder fund?
Reliance Capital Builder Fund is an open-ended equity scheme offered by Reliance Mutual Fund that aims to generate long-term capital appreciation through investments in equity and equity-related instruments.
